1 of 5 stars Reviewed 17 March 2013

Room was overheated, and adjustments did not ease the hot temperature. We also found stink bugs and suspect the keys may fit all if not multiple rooms. Stay was not as pleasant as we had hoped. Breakfast was decent, and location is great. Outside view and dining area was cute. Owners pets were cute.
